The periodic table is a table made of 7 periods (rows) and 18 groups (columns). It is organized by the increasing order of the atomic number.
Noble gases are colorless, odorless, and tasteless gases that are nonreactive due to their stable electron configuration. They are located in group 18 of the periodic table and have complete outer electron shells. These gases have low melting and boiling points, making them useful in applications where inert atmospheres are needed.
The modern periodic table is useful because it organizes elements based on their atomic number and similar chemical properties. This arrangement helps predict the behavior of elements, their reactivity, and their physical properties. It also provides a systematic way to study and understand the relationships between different elements.
The periodic table is the most useful source of information about the chemical elements. It organizes the elements based on their atomic number, electron configuration, and recurring chemical properties. It provides a wealth of information about each element, including its symbol, atomic weight, and various properties.
GA in the periodic table stands for Gallium. Gallium is a metal that is soft and silvery in appearance. It has a melting point just above room temperature, making it useful in certain types of thermometers.
The 32nd element on the periodic table is Germanium (Ge). It is a metalloid with properties that make it useful in semiconductor applications.
